Use the trigonometric identities to transform one side of the equation to the other (0

Solution

a) cot x sin x = cos x

simplifying the left hand side

cot x = cos x / sin x

so left side becomes

cos x / sin x * sin x

cos x = cos x

left hand side = right hand side

proved !

b) ( 1 + sin x ) ( 1 - sin x ) = cos^2 x

applying foil on left side to multiply

1 - sinx + sin x - sin^2 x

1 - sin^2 x

applying trigonometric identity

sin^2 x + cos^2 x = 1

( sin^2 x + cos ^2 x ) - sin^2 x

so we are left with cos^2 x on left side

hence,

cos^2 x = cos^2 x

proved !
